  • She made it all up! A 22 year old woman, evidently homesick for her boyfriend in Taiwan, lied to police about being assaulted in a school parking lot on October 21. Her story fell apart quickly and Detectives found her clothes in a dumpster near where she works. She’s being charged with a misdemeanor and could face one year in jail SIGNAL

  • Tim Patterson, a TV commercial director from Santa Clarita, suddenly found himself in possession of film worth potentially millions of dollars. What was it? The last footage of Michael Jackson. Patterson eventually got to edit and direct (somewhat) the film “This is It”, which has grossed over $100 million. Remarkable story at LA TIMES
